Juche

Juche (/dʒuːˈtʃeɪ/; ; Korean: 주체; lit. subject; Korean pronunciation: [tɕutɕʰe]; usually left untranslated or translated as "self-reliance") is the official ideology of the Democratic People's Republic of Korea described by the government as "Kim Il-sung's original, brilliant and revolutionary contribution to national and international thought". It postulates that "man is the master of his destiny", that the masses are to act as the "masters of the revolution and construction", and that by becoming self-reliant and strong, a nation can achieve true socialism.
